Durham Law School is a world leader in legal education and research. Our LLB degree is a flexible, full-time course delivered over three years.

The LLB provides students with an excellent understanding of the law of England and Wales as well as legal research and practice. In addition to undertaking a number of core or foundational modules students also have the opportunity to specialise across a wide range of optional modules as well as the option of taking one module in another subject area during their LLB.

Award-winning legal education

Durham’s academic staff have won numerous awards for teaching excellence. Our undergraduate modules are taught through a combination of lectures, small group tutorials of 8-10 students, seminar groups and private study by many of the leaders in the field.

An exciting place to learn law

The Law School is a great place to learn law. We are a large and vibrant community of internationally recognised scholars and practitioners who are passionate about sharing our interest and understanding of law with those we teach.

A top 60 QS World Ranked Law School, we deliver world-leading and award-winning teaching with a firm commitment to small group teaching in seminars and our tutorial system much prized by employers. Alongside your studies, you will have the opportunity to engage in a growing number of extra-curricular activities led by law students. These include mooting, debating and working on a range of pro bono activities. You will also benefit from our close relationships with a range of leading employers.
